Description

Michalis Kontaxakis, First Prize Winner in the 2005 International Francisco Tarrega Guitar Competition, is considered today to be one of the leading young Greek guitarists. He studied the guitar with Vassilis Mastorakis and Costas Cotsiolis, and at the Robert Schumann Musikhochschule in Duesseldorf. In this recital, featuring a guitar made by Alkis, Athens, he performs the world premiere recording of "Preludios de Primavera" (Preludes of Spring) by Joaquin Clerch, and Tarrega's enchanting Fantasy on themes from "La Traviata".
